There's a couple tricks you can try to make greens more appealing to him. You can try raining the salad down on him, some beardies get tricked by 'salad from the heavens' and will eat it on impulse. Something that helps my beardie personally eat is wiggling the salad in front of him, either by waving a piece in front of his nose or by sticking my finger in the bowl and moving the salad. Bright colours like squash and red or yellow peppers will also make them want to eat. And you can put a super or two in the salad, the movement of the worms will make him wanna eat more.
As to him eating too much protein, beardies can grow until they're two, so higher protein shouldn't be too much of a problem until he's over the two year mark. I would start trying to incorporate more veggies into his diet now so the transition to more veggies less worms will be easier on him.

Hi, thought I would jump in here and make some suggestions and add some info.

Roccosmama, it's a good idea to offer at least 2 different feeders so that they don't get tired of them. Great that he is doing so well and has gained some weight. 8) Silkworms, hornworms and roaches are all good ones to feed as well as the supers. Since you're not feeding the full sized supers, the amount can actually be a little higher than the suggested amount for his age. We usually suggest 35 large feeders (like full sized supers) or 50 small feeders (like crickets) a wk. Beardies continue to grow more up until the age of about 2 yrs but it would be a good idea to try to entice him to eat more greens now. When they are 2 years plus and they are fed a large amount of protein, it can cause liver and kidney problems later on so that's the reason for limiting their feeder intake as they get older.
